### Step 4: Reconfigure the alert fan-out

In the legacy Stormcaller pipeline, weather alerts were pushed to every subscriber from a single worker, which caused backlogs during the Harwick flood season. The new fan-out service shards subscribers by region and retries per-shard rather than globally. Before starting the migrated workers, copy the fan-out settings into your environment exactly as written — mismatched shard counts between workers will silently drop alerts. The settings you need for this step are the following.

config for kafof-bawef:
holath:
  log_level: debug
  metrics_host: metrics.holath.qorvelsys.internal
  pin: 2191
  pool_size: 32

Quarterly Planning Note — Finance Team, Brindlecote Goods. Re: pricing of the Selvane product line. Input costs rose four percent, driven by resin and freight from the Marrow Point depot. We propose a tiered increase: three percent on standard units, five on premium, effective next quarter. Elasticity modelling suggests minimal volume loss. Competitor moves from Quarrow Ltd remain a watch item. Our confidential pricing strategy follows in the note below.

internal memo for kawip-hadug: Headcount on the Wenwyn team goes from 7 to 140 by the end of January. Gross margin on Wenwyn came in at 20 percent against a plan of 15 percent.

TURN-208: Gatevale turnstile counters at the Merrow Field pilot double-count when a rotation reverses mid-cycle. Attendance totals drift roughly 2% high per event. The debounce window fix is implemented, reviewed by Ilsa, and soak-tested across two simulated match days without drift. Ready for your cut; the candidate build is identified below.

trace token, tagag-tafog: htk6_5ed18c